1800s Spinning wheel sold at the J.W. Howes store in Montpelier  

Montpelier Vermont Historical Society Posted on February 27, 2025 by adminMarch 3, 2025

Spinning wheels were a common sight in Montpelier homes in the 1700s and early 1800s when many housewives spun their own linen thread or wool yarn. This wheel was known as a “great wheel” or “walking wheel” because the user … Continue reading →

– 1822 – Military Academy Cadets hike from Norwich to Montpelier

Montpelier Vermont Historical Society Posted on January 10, 2023 by adminApril 19, 2023

A Long Walk to Montpelier – 1822 by Paul Heller      On October 11, 1822 the cadets from Captain Partridge’s American Literary, Scientific, and Military Academy left Norwich, Vermont to embark on an eight-day march to Montpelier and back. … Continue reading →
